PayPoint and SGF partner to support Scottish retailers

PayPoint has partnered with the Scottish Grocers Federation (SGF) to support convenience retailer partners in Scotland.

The partnership will see PayPoint join as a corporate member of the trade association which is the authoritative voice of the Scottish convenience store sector and will be focusing on rebuilding relationships with retailer partners, engaging more regularly and strengthening propositions to deliver better products, service and value to their businesses.

The two organisations will also be exploring ways to support the industry and retailer partners further with issues such as DRS, Access to Cash and post-Covid-19 economic recovery in Scotland.

The move comes after several positive meetings between the senior leadership teams of both organisations, including Pete Cheema, chief executive of SGF, and PayPoint chief executive Nick Wiles.

“We’re delighted to be joining the SGF again as an active corporate member and I would like to thank Pete and his team for their constructive engagement to date,” Wiles said

“Over the coming year, there will be many exciting growth opportunities for our retailer partners and we are looking forward to working closely with the SGF to help our Scottish convenience retailer partners get the most out of PayPoint in their stores.”

Cheema added: “We warmly welcome this exciting new partnership between SGF and PayPoint and we are committed to making it a success.

“The recent high-level engagement between the two organisations has shown clearly that we have the same aims and objectives in supporting retailers, maximising business development opportunities and working collaboratively.

“Being a member of SGF will ensure that PayPoint is an integral part of the convenience sector in Scotland.”
